All inclusive tour includes a private driver that will pick you up at your specified hotel (pick up times will be confirmed the evening before the tour). We will stop for a typical Costa Rican breakfast and take you to the river by private car.

Once we have arrived to the Pejivaje River, you will be greeted by your guides and given instructions to keep your group safe while enjoying the thrill of the river. We will provide bottled water to keep you hydrated during the excursion, fresh towels to dry off with, pictures taken during your experience, and lunch to keep your energy up!

The tour will include 2 laps of the river, and approx. 3 hours floating and riding the rapids while taking in the beautiful jungle surroundings.

Once finished we will bring you back to your hotel!

About San José

San José, the capital of Costa Rica, is a vibrant city known for its rich cultural heritage, bustling markets, and colonial architecture. Nestled in the heart of the Central Valley, it offers a unique blend of urban life and natural beauty, with nearby volcanoes and coffee plantations adding to its allure.

Must-Try Local Dishes

Gallo Pinto

A traditional breakfast dish made with rice, beans, onions, and peppers, often served with eggs, tortillas, and natilla (sour cream).

Breakfast Vegetarian

Casado

A typical lunch dish consisting of rice, beans, salad, plantains, and a choice of meat or fish.

Lunch Can be vegetarian or vegan with modifications

Olla de Carne

A hearty beef and vegetable soup, often served with rice, tortillas, and salad.

Dinner Can be made vegetarian

Chifrijo

A popular bar snack made with fried pork, beans, rice, and avocado.

Safety Information

Overall Safety Rating: Exercise caution

San José is generally safe for tourists, but petty crime such as pickpocketing and bag snatching can occur, especially in crowded areas. Exercise caution and keep valuables secure.
